Understanding the Core Mechanics of Online Casino Games

At the heart of any online casino lies a sophisticated set of algorithms and random number generators (RNGs) that ensure fairness and unpredictability. These RNGs are meticulously tested and certified by independent auditing firms, providing players with the assurance that the outcomes of the games are genuinely random and not manipulated in any way. Different games have differing mechanics; for instance, slot games rely heavily on RNGs to determine symbol combinations, while table games like blackjack involve a degree of strategic skill combined with luck. The probability of winning remains a key aspect that players consider when choosing which games to play.

Understanding Wagering Requirements

Wagering requirements, also known as playthrough requirements, represent the total amount of money a player must wager before they can convert bonus funds into real cash. For example, a bonus with a 30x wagering requirement means that if a player receives a $100 bonus, they must wager $3,000 before they can withdraw any associated winnings. It’s crucial to factor these requirements into your decision-making process when choosing a bonus; a seemingly generous offer may be less appealing if the wagering requirements are excessive. Players should also be aware of game weighting, where certain games contribute less towards fulfilling the wagering requirements. Table games often have a lower contribution percentage than slots.

Exploring Cryptocurrency Options

In recent years, cryptocurrencies like Bitcoin and Ethereum have gained popularity as viable payment methods for online casinos. These offer several advantages, including enhanced security, faster transaction times, and increased anonymity. However, it’s important to note that not all online casinos accept cryptocurrency, and fluctuations in cryptocurrency values can impact the value of your deposits and withdrawals. Players should familiarize themselves with the specific policies of the casino regarding cryptocurrency transactions and associated risks. The decentralized nature of cryptocurrencies provides an additional layer of security, but also places the responsibility for secure storage on the individual user.

Responsible Gaming and Self-Regulation

While online casinos provide entertainment and the potential for winnings, it’s crucial to approach them with a responsible mindset. Problem gambling can have devastating consequences, both financially and emotionally. Reputable online casinos offer various tools and resources to help players manage their gambling habits, including deposit limits, loss limits, self-exclusion options, and links to support organizations. Recognizing the signs of problem gambling, such as chasing losses, gambling with money you can’t afford to lose, or neglecting personal responsibilities, is the first step towards seeking help. Setting boundaries and sticking to them is an integral part of responsible gaming.
